Veteran actor Sudhir Dalvi, remembered fondly for playing Sai Baba in Manoj Kumar’s 1977 classic Shirdi Ke Saibaba, has been admitted to Mumbai’s Lilavati Hospital since October 8. The 86-year-old actor is reportedly fighting severe sepsis, and his condition has left his family struggling to manage rising medical costs. According to reports, Dalvi’s hospital bills have already exceeded Rs 10 lakh, with doctors estimating total expenses may reach around Rs 15 lakh. His family has reached out to members of the film and television fraternity for financial support. The news has stirred emotions among fans who grew up watching Dalvi’s soulful performances on screen.
Riddhima Kapoor Sahni Steps In and Faces a Troll

Among those who extended help was Riddhima Kapoor Sahni, daughter of late actor Rishi Kapoor and Neetu Kapoor, and sister to Ranbir Kapoor. Riddhima, who recently appeared in Fabulous Lives vs Bollywood Wives Season 3, made a donation for the veteran actor’s treatment and commented on a paparazzo post, writing, “Done. Wishing him a speedy recovery.”
However, her good deed quickly became the target of online negativity when a troll replied, “Why did u mention here if you have helped… footage chahiye?” Refusing to ignore the remark, Riddhima calmly responded, “Everything in life is not about optics – helping someone in need and in whatever capacity you can is the biggest blessing.”
Her dignified response soon went viral, earning her praise for calling out unnecessary cynicism and reminding social media users of the importance of empathy over judgment.
Remembering the Man Behind the Iconic Roles
Sudhir Dalvi’s contribution to Indian cinema and television spans over five decades. Apart from his iconic portrayal of Sai Baba, he played Rishi Vashishtha in Ramanand Sagar’s Ramayan (1987) and appeared in films like Junoon (1978) and Chandni (1989). He continued to act through the 1990s and early 2000s, last seen in the film Xcuse Me (2003) and the TV show Woh Huye Na Hamare (2006).
